Vincent Demeester
15318c4631 Fix docker labels (frontend.*)
Using Docker provider, you can specify `traefik.frontend.rule` and
`traefik.frontend.value` labels. If they are not both provided, there is
a default behavior. On the current master, if they are not defined, the
container is filtered (and thus the default behavior is broken).

Fixes that.

Vincent Demeester
3c9ec55f0a Updates and additions on some integration tests
- Use defer to kill traefik process (to fix the still running traefik
  binaries if the given tests is failing before the kill)
- Add TestWithWebConfig
- Add *.test to gitignore to ignore the test binaries generated by go.
